GlossyBox is a beauty subscription service box that allows customers to sample products monthly. Sampling lets the subscriber fall in love with new products and become life-long brand advocates. Each box is filled with five makeup, hair and skin care products from top brands.

Well, technically you can’t skip, you just cancel and resubscribe. But if you want to not receive a box (and more importantly, not pay for it!) you have to cancel by the 15th of the month prior. So if you are wishy washy on March, make sure you cancel by Feb 15th. And then once the March spoilers come out if you want to that box you have to resubscribe ASAP so that you end up with the March box and don’t miss out.
